Creative freelancers: we need your help!

If you consider yourself a "creative freelancer," we need your help.

Peleg and I are teaming up with the folks at HOW magazine to produce a one-of-a-kind conference for creative freelancers to take place in 2008.

This conference will be created for designers, illustrators, copywriters, photographers and anyone who wants to earn a living by selling their creative services.

We're looking to create an event that is focused, affordable and provides lots of networking. But first, we need to know what you want/need. We hope that you can take a quick 3-minute survey and share some of your thoughts about this idea.
